Trying to update IP Camera settings by putting the camera IP address in the address bar but keep getting the message that site is not secure. any fixes?

Will Firefox let you use http:// with the IP address or does it say it can only use https:// ? If you delete the s and press Enter to load without it, what happens?

If that doesn't work, or you really want a secure connection, could you copy/paste from the error page the additional information and/or error code (similar to SEC_ERROR_SOMETHING)? Sometimes you need to click an Advanced button to find the details.

Browsers will return a "connection not secure" error when they can't verify a website's SSL certificate. SSL is a secure data-encryption method that keeps transmitted data private and safe.
